**Runbook: soft deletes — Marrowtide orders**

Orders are never hard-deleted. Set `deleted_at`; the Gullwick sweeper archives rows after 90 days. Never null the timestamp to "restore" — use the restore endpoint so audit rows stay consistent. If counts look wrong, check the sweeper lag first. Reference the deploy token noted below.

session token of tajef-bageg = htk21_5d90d574934f3ccae6437

MEMO — Finance Team Only

Subject: Potential acquisition of Brindlewave Systems

We have entered preliminary talks with Brindlewave's owners. Initial valuation range: 4.2–4.8x trailing revenue. Diligence starts next week; Petra Halvorsen leads. Do not book any provisions yet, and keep all modeling in the restricted folder. External advisors signed NDAs Tuesday. Treat every inquiry from outside the team as unauthorized until I say otherwise. The rationale and next steps are summarized below.

internal memo for kawip-hadug: Headcount on the Wenwyn team goes from 7 to 140 by the end of January. Gross margin on Wenwyn came in at 20 percent against a plan of 15 percent.

Subject: Handover — RestockWise planner DB

Hi Marta,

Taking over RestockWise, the vending-machine restock planner, from me as of Friday. Key things for support escalations: the planner recalculates routes nightly at 02:00, and stale inventory counts usually mean the telemetry sync lagged — rerun the sync job before touching anything else. Backups run hourly with a 14-day window; restores have been tested quarterly. For direct queries during incidents, use the read replica, reachable via the connection string below.

Thanks,
Odile

primary connection of tajeg-tajop = postgresql://julax_svc:DI@db-e7f3.kelvidyn.corp:5432/rusdor

Ticket PIXTRIM-482 — Configuration drift in batch resize CLI

Plugin authors have reported that `pixtrim batch` behaves differently across installs: some environments default to Lanczos resampling while others use bilinear, and JPEG quality varies between 82 and 90. The drift comes from stale per-machine config files shadowing the shipped defaults. We will enforce a single canonical configuration in v3.1 and warn on overrides. For reference, the intended canonical values are as follows.

deployment values, tafof-taduf:
pelius:
  pin: 6508
  tenant: praiel
  seal: seal_4e33a2f4
  metrics_host: metrics.pelius.plorvagrid.corp
  standby_team: druix
  escalation: juldor-norius
  nonce: 5db598